The Tefal Express Optimal Steam Generator Iron (SV4110G0) is designed for individuals seeking efficient and powerful garment care. Its key benefit is delivering up to three times more steam than a traditional iron, significantly reducing ironing time and tackling tough creases with ease. A potential caveat is its reliance on a water tank, requiring refills for extended use. This compact yet powerful unit offers a 5-bar pump, continuous steam output, and a steam boost for stubborn wrinkles, all while featuring Calc Clear technology for simple maintenance and a smooth Xpress Glide soleplate.

FAQs

How often should I use the Calc Clear technology?

You should rinse the Calc Clear collector regularly, typically after every few uses or when prompted by the appliance if it has an indicator. This helps maintain optimal performance and prevents limescale buildup.

Can I use distilled water in the Tefal Express Optimal?

While tap water is generally suitable, if you have very hard water, it's recommended to use a mixture of tap and distilled water or consult your user manual for specific guidance on water types to protect the appliance.

How do I clean the soleplate?

Once the iron has cooled down completely, wipe the Xpress Glide soleplate with a soft, damp cloth. Avoid using abrasive cleaners that could damage the surface.

What is the warranty period for this product?

The Tefal Express Optimal Steam Generator Iron comes with a 2-year guarantee from the date of purchase.

Is the water tank removable for easy filling?

The provided description does not specify if the water tank is removable. Please refer to the product manual or Tefal's official website for detailed information on tank removability.

How long does it take to heat up?

The iron is designed for quick heat-up, allowing you to start ironing shortly after turning it on. Specific heat-up times can be found in the user manual.

What are the dimensions of the iron?

The dimensions are H:27.2 x W:16.0 x D:30.8 cm, making it an ultra-compact unit.

Troubleshooting

No steam is produced

Ensure the iron has heated up sufficiently (indicator light is on). Check that the water tank is full and properly seated. Verify that the steam button is being pressed.

Water is leaking from the soleplate

Allow the iron to fully heat up. Ensure the water tank is not overfilled. Check that the Calc Clear collector is correctly in place. If the issue persists, descale the unit.

Iron is not heating up

Check the power connection and ensure the outlet is working. Try a different power outlet. If the problem continues, contact customer support.

Poor steam output or performance

Check the water level and refill if necessary. Ensure the Calc Clear collector is clean and free of limescale. Use the steam boost function for tougher creases.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

Setup:

  1. Fill the water tank with tap water (or distilled water if your local water is very hard, as recommended by Tefal).
  2. Ensure the iron is connected to the base unit.
  3. Plug the appliance into a suitable power outlet.
  4. Turn on the iron and allow it to heat up. The indicator light will show when it's ready.

Compatibility:

This steam generator iron is suitable for all types of fabrics. Always check the garment's care label before ironing.

Care:

  • Calc Clear Technology: Regularly rinse the limescale collector as per the instruction manual to ensure longevity and performance. This typically involves removing and rinsing the collector under a tap.
  • Soleplate Cleaning: After use and once cooled, wipe the Xpress Glide soleplate with a damp cloth to remove any residue.
  • Storage: Empty the water tank before storing. Store the iron upright in a cool, dry place. The compact design aids in easy storage.
  • Water Type: Use tap water. If you have very hard water, consider using a mix of tap and distilled water or consult the user manual for specific recommendations.
